Scour is the removal of sediment around piers due to flowing water. Which of the following is a typical countermeasure?

Explanation:
Scour around piers is addressed by protecting the foundation from flowing water. The best countermeasure is to place rock armor (riprap) around the pier, with a protective apron downstream and monitoring of scour depth. The rock armor dissipates flow energy and shields the base from erosion, while the apron helps spread and reduce scour in front of and around the pier, and monitoring allows timely maintenance if scour progresses. Other options don’t tackle the erosion mechanism: increasing deck thickness changes only the superstructure, not the foundation protection; painting the pier offers no protective effect against sediment removal; and raising the abutments target areas away from the pier foundation in the main flow, so it doesn’t mitigate scour at the pier itself.
